Response to Comment on "Arsenic(III) Fuels Anoxygenic Photosynthesis in Hot Spring Biofilms from Mono Lake, California"

R. S. Oremland, J. F. Stolz, M. Madigan, J. T. Hollibaugh, T. R. Kulp, S. E. Hoeft, J. Fisher, L. G. Miller, C. W. Culbertson, M. Asao
2009 Science  
Schoepp-Cothenet et al. bring a welcome conceptual debate to the question of which came first in the course of planetary biological evolution, arsenite [As(III)] oxidation or dissimilatory arsenate [As(V)] reduction. However, we disagree with their reasoning and stand by our original conclusion.
